LaVerne (aka “Fluffy”) was born in Chapman, Nebraska on December 28th, 1929 to William and Rose (Husak) Kozisek. Growing up, he loved helping his Dad on the family farm and this is where he developed his lifelong love of farming. He attended Marietta Catholic School near Bellwood, NE until his father passed away. The family then moved to David City where LaVerne graduated from David City High School in 1948.

After high school, LaVerne joined the armed forces and was later honorably discharged. After several odd jobs, he began renting a farm south of David City. On October 2nd, 1965, LaVerne married Norma Jean Matthies of Council Bluffs, Iowa at St. Patrick’s Catholic Church in Council Bluffs. They lovingly raised four sons and eventually purchased their own farm east of David City.


His greatest loves in life were his faith, his family, and farming. He was an active member of St. Mary’s Church and served as an Acolyte for many years. He was also involved in the creation of Aquinas High School and was a 4th Degree Knight with the Knights of Columbus. He raised crops and livestock on his farm and later began a 20-plus year career as the Butler County Weed Superintendent. He always enjoyed attending school events for his children and later on, his grandchildren. He loved being a grandpa.


LaVerne was always kind and caring and people loved being around him. He was always happy to share whatever he had. When he was younger, he had several family members live at his house. When his Mom was re-married, he welcomed his new family into his own. He also loved being a farming role-model for all the neighborhood children who enjoyed being a part of a family farm. Although he was around livestock his whole life, he had a special way with dogs and they adored him.
